"Functioning with the quadruped MekaMon robot, Reach EDU will utlise MekaMon's sophisticated locomotion and personality to entertain, inspire and educate students from across the academic spectrum by bringing creative learning and advanced robotics together.
Operating alongside the existing MekaMon gaming app, Reach EDU will launch with six guided missions to support the KS2 Computer Science curriculum with plans to formally expand into KS3 and 4 in the next academic year."
"Teachers in England are being invited to join a professional development opportunity through EarthEcho International sponsored by the Northrop Grumman Foundation. The 'EarthEcho Expeditions: What's the Catch?' programme leverages the rich Cousteau legacy of exploration and discovery to bring Science, Technology, Engineering and Mathematics (STEM) education alive for today's 21st-century learners and their educators.
The free, expenses-paid opportunity is planned to allow secondary school teachers to participate as Expedition Fellows to learn first-hand from scientists and engineers the consequences of fisheries mismanagement and how this can be changed for the better with new technological approaches and discoveries."

Girls who play video games are three times more likely to choose physical science, technology, engineering or maths (PSTEM) degrees compared to their non-gaming counterparts, according to new research from the University of Surrey

"New research from Monash University has found that girls in single-sex schools are more likely to study chemistry, intermediate mathematics, advanced mathematics and physics in their senior years when compared to their co-ed counterparts."
"Countries with greater gender equality see a smaller proportion of women taking degrees in science, technology, engineering and mathematics (STEM), a new study has found. Policymakers could use the findings to reconsider initiatives to increase women's participation in STEM, say the researchers.
Dubbed the 'gender equality paradox', the research found that countries such as Albania and Algeria have a greater percentage of women amongst their STEM graduates than countries lauded for their high levels of gender equality, such as Finland, Norway or Sweden."

"English…done! Reading…done! Assembly…go, go, go! Packed primary timetables can sometimes feel like you're racing through an army drill. It can be difficult to stop, and allow children time for deeper thought and study. Integrating meaningful STEM into the week can often feel like a bit of a headache. Project Based Learning as a method of teaching STEM, could be the solution to this. Science, Technology, Engineering and Maths are the four disciplines many schools are hoping to focus on this academic year, looking at an applied and integrated approach."
